Kristy Hansen
B.A., B.S.W. (Hons.), R.S.W., J.D.
Having been born and raised in the small town of Manitouwadge, Ontario, I moved to Thunder Bay in 2008 to pursue my education. I became a registered social worker and developed my social work skills as a child protection worker and family counsellor. During my time as a counsellor, I also ran parenting programs for parents of high-needs children and taught coping skills to children with behavioural difficulties. As a lawyer, I continue to be passionate about mental health and advocating for families and children in crisis.
